[Core] Профили

Bug #291321 reported by mixer_msk
2
Affects Status Importance Assigned to Milestone
Mixer Site System
Confirmed
High
Unassigned

Bug Description

Необходимо создать на базе основных классов движка полноценное пользовательское профилирование. Возможности:
1. "Гибкие" поля
2. Загрузка/изменение аватарки
3. Смена пароля
4. Смена e-mail`a
5. Восстановление пароля(нужна функция для работы с почтой с возможностью использования шаблонов).
6. Возможность скрещивания с плагинами без правки основных классов/шаблонов.
7. Анти-бот при регистрации.

Отдельной страницей:
1. Дата регистрации
2. Группа
3. Аватар
4. Вывод гибких полей.
5. Вывод полей с плагинов.

"Квадратом"(на статьях, комментариях, фотографиях, etc):
1. Аватар
2. Группа
3. Дата регистрации
4. Карма?(подумать надо ли оно вообще)

mixer_msk (mixermsk)
Changed in mss:
importance: Undecided → Critical
status: New → Confirmed
description: updated
Revision history for this message
mixer_msk (mixermsk) wrote :

Поправка - делать плагином.

mixer_msk (mixermsk)
Changed in mss:
importance: Critical → High
Revision history for this message
mixer_msk (mixermsk) wrote :

Итак. Первичное:
1. Выносить все пользовательские функции в плагин(админка в этом плане живет отдельно - для управления доступом).
2. В таблицу - дату регистрации, с соответствующими поправками в функциях.
3. На отдельной странице: диалог о смене пароля.
4. На отдельной странице: диалог о восстановлении пароля.

To post a comment you must log in.
This report contains Public information  
Everyone can see this information.

Other bug subscribers

Remote bug watches

Bug watches keep track of this bug in other bug trackers.